PlayStation State of Play Announced For September 24, 2025

PlayStation has some great games in the works about which we don’t know much at all. So, naturally, fans have been waiting for a showcase event for a long time, and now, finally, the wait doesn’t have to last any longer. 

Sony has officially revealed that the PlayStation State of Play is set to happen tomorrow. There are reports of a bunch of upcoming titles that could even include those from some popular exclusive franchises. 

Why it matters: This year’s event has been a long time coming, as fans have been speculating a lot. Also, since the PS5 generation has been kind of underwhelming in terms of games, expectations are high. 

State of Play
Sony has announced a new State of Play for tomorrow

The State of Play is set to happen on September 24, 2025, at 2:00 PM PT/5:00 ET. It’ll be about 35 minutes long and can be streamed on PlayStation’s official YouTube and Twitch. And let’s just say major reveals are expected. 

For starters, Marvel’s Wolverine is finally rumored to show up after years of absence. Naughty Dog’s new IP, Intergalactic: The Heretic Prophet, might also get a new trailer. However, the biggest reveal could be God of War.

The next mainline entry seemingly takes Kratos to Egypt in a new adventure. Moreover, we can also expect new footage for Ghost of Yotei, Housemarque’s Saros, and more, so it’s expected to be an action-packed event.
